Are you a nonprofit organization looking for a way to collect donations? A donate form can be a great way to do this, and WordPress is a great platform to create one on. In this article, we’ll show you how to create a donate form for nonprofit organizations using WordPress.

Creating a Donate Form in WordPress

First, you’ll need to install and activate the WPForms plugin. For more details, see our step by step guide on how to install a WordPress plugin.

Upon activation, you’ll need to visit the WPForms » Add New page to create a new form.

On the next screen, you’ll need to give your form a name and then select the Donations form template.

This will launch the WPForms form builder with the donation form template pre-loaded. You can now start customize the form fields and other settings.

You can add, edit, or delete the existing form fields by dragging and dropping them. WPForms comes with pre-built smart fields for collecting donations. These are the Donation Amount, Donation Note, and Credit Card fields.

The Donation Amount field lets people specify how much they want to donate. The Donation Note field can be used to add a note explaining the donation. The Credit Card field is used to input credit card information.

You can also add new form fields from the left panel. WPForms comes with a wide variety of form fields that you can add to your form.

Once you are satisfied with the form fields, you can click on the Settings tab to configure the general settings for your form.

On the Settings tab, you can configure the form name, description, andapal settings. You can also enable form confirmation settings and choose how you want to redirect users after a successful donation (i.e. to a thank you page).

WPForms also allows you to enablereCaptha and anti-spam settings to protect your form from spam submissions.

Once you are done configuring the settings, you can click on the Save button to store your changes.

Now that you have created your WordPress donation form, it’s time to add it to your website.

Adding WordPress Donation Form to Your Website

There are two ways to add your WordPress donation form to your website.

You can either add it to a post or page, or you can display it in a sidebar widget.

Adding WPForms to a Post or Page

Adding WPForms to a post or page is very easy. Simply edit the post or page where you want to add the form and click on the Add Form button.

This will bring up a popup where you can select the form you want to add.

Once you have selected the form, you can click on the Add Form button to insert it into your post or page.

Adding WPForms to a Sidebar Widget

If you want to display your WordPress donation form in a sidebar widget, then you’ll need to add the WPForms widget to your sidebar.

First, you need to visit the Appearance » Widgets page and drag the WPForms widget to your sidebar.

Next, you need to select the form you want to display in the sidebar.

Once you are done, click on the Save button to store your changes.

Your WordPress donation form is now ready and you should start seeing donations coming in.
